Summary

The purpose of this study is to determine whether an array of biosensors can noninvasively identify hyperglycemic or hypoglycemic events in persons diagnosed with diabetes through noninvasive detection of volatile organic compounds (VOCs) in exhaled breath.

Interventions

DEVICESensing Device and Tedlar Bags

Children diagnosed with diabetes that wear a continuous glucose monitor (CGM) will provide breath samples into the miniaturized sensing device (as well as Tedlar bags for GC-MS analysis) during euglycemia, hypoglycemia, and hyperglycemia. The breath data will be analyzed to draw correlations with blood glucose levels measured via CGMs and finger prick tests.
